Women's Hockey Falls To Hamilton, 2-0, In NESCAC Quarterfinals

CLINTON, N.Y. – The fifth-seeded Trinity College Women's Hockey team suffered a 2-0 defeat to four-seed Hamilton College in the New England Small College Athletic Conference (NESCAC) Championship Quarterfinals at Russell Sage Rink Saturday evening.

The Bantams sit with a 15-7-2 record and will look to continue their season with a potential at-large bid to the NCAA Division III Women's Hockey Championship Tournament. Hamilton improves to 14-5-6 overall and will face top-seeded Amherst College in the Semifinal Saturday at 4:00 p.m.

Just over six minutes into the first period and midway through a Bantams power play, the Continentals cracked the scoreboard as Abby Smith netted a short-handed goal to stake Hamilton to a 1-0 lead.

Late in the second period, the Continentals potted an insurance goal as Lydia Bullock found the back of the net on a Hamilton power play.

Hamilton edged Trinity in the shot column, 28-24, while the Bantams controlled the faceoff circle, 34-20, during the contest. Trinity senior goaltender Hannah Leclair made a game-high 26 saves, while Mac Donovan posted a shutout with 24 saves for the Continentals.
